Reverend Daniel Valente

Father Daniel Valente, M.S.A., grew up in Southington, CT. He attended Penn State University, earning a Bachelor of Science in Secondary Education. He went on to teach for fifteen years after college prior to entering religious life and seminary in 2017. He received both his Master of Divinity and Master of Arts in Sacred Scripture from Holy Apostles College & Seminary in Cromwell, CT. Father Dan was ordained to the priesthood on May eleventh, 2024, by Archbishop Christopher J. Coyne. Father Dan is a member of the Missionaries of the Holy Apostles (M.S.A.), a Society of Apostolic Life working in eleven countries, whose mission and charism is to promote, form, and accompany youths and adults in their vocation to the priesthood and to other ministries in the Church. Fr. Dan enjoys spending time outdoors, reading, sports, and visiting with his extended family and friends.
